## Requirements

**Technical Skills Requirements:**

-   **Full Stack Development:** Strong experience using TypeScript across frontend and backend
-   **Backend:** 5+ years working with Node.js, preferably using FastifyJS or NestJS
-   **Frontend:** Advanced proficiency in ReactJS and Next.js
-   **APIs:** Proven experience designing secure, scalable RESTful APIs
-   **Telephony & Communication:** 2+ years integrating Twilio (voice, SMS, or automation workflows)
-   **DevOps:** Hands-on experience with Docker and containerized environments
-   **Payments & Integrations:** Experience with Stripe (SaaS subscriptions) and Zapier developer integrations
-   **AI Workflow Orchestration:** Experience with prompt engineering and frameworks such as LangChain or LlamaIndex
-   **Leadership Experience:** Proven experience leading or mentoring a development team, including guiding technical decisions, conducting code reviews, supporting career growth, and collaborating with cross-functional stakeholders.
-   **Problem-Solving:** Strong ability to troubleshoot complex systems and deliver elegant solutions
